Background • I: Technology has been developed, but still breakthrough waited • Japanese Toshiba, NEC, Hitachi, Fujitsu and Casio take lead (wow, they are the losers in secondary battery…does it happen by accident?), the first product will be launched soon in 05CY (but they said “07CY would be the target year”…) • Japanese NTT and KDDI expect FC can be “new power device” for 3.5/4G • Sad news is the stopping of Nokia’s FC development • II: What is the killer application? • Cellular phone with TV tuner and HDD REC/PLAY • NBPC which runs 10-100 hours • Electric motor bike for ecology • It seems that co-generation system for house is more promising in Japan • III: Conclusion: 1st gen FC will not compete with secondary battery • FC is charger as accessory, still equipment needs internal LIB/Laminate • If users accept such a device, which can be the next step for 2nd gen FC • If FC charger performs good, which can be the driving force to expand portable equipment market and secondary battery industry would be also happy • If IIT is consulting someone, we recommend to develop 2 cells 18650 charger with built-in AC-charger for power consuming cellular Positive impact on rechargeable battery business Source: Takeshita April 2005

LiB/LiP total Market volume = 1.25 Billion units in 2003 PositionCompany Volume (M Cells) 1 Sanyo 350 2 Sony 250 3 BYD (China) 125 4 MBI (Matsushita) 100 5 SDI ( Samsung) 75 6 LG 32 7 GSMT (Sanyo) 30 8 ATB (Toshiba) ~20 8 companies represent ~ 80% LiB/LiP marketshare Assessment of application entrance strategy

  7. Mobility is rapidly increasing (Laptop, Cellphone, PDA, MP3...) Product life cycle of mobile devices is shortening Run time of mobile devices and number of features is increasing Power source (Battery) capacity must increase Application power consumption must decrease Different technical requirements depending on application (speciality markets) Market Overview: Portable Device Drivers Assessment of application entrance strategy

  8. Assessment of application entrance strategy Market Overview: Battery Drivers • Energy density (volume, weight) • Power density (volume, weight) • Device design (form factor) • Environmental conditions (temperature) • Safety (UL)
